Contact us

If you would like more information on the services we offer please use one of the contact options below.


Phone: +44 (0) 20 8546 4352

Post: Arcaid Images, 33-34 Market Place, Reading, RG1 2DE. United Kingdom

Company details: Capture Ltd Registered Number 03669825

BT Tower, 60 Cleveland Street, Camden, London. General view of tower, formerly The Post Office Tower.

Your download will start shortly, please do not navigate away from this page until the download prompt has appeared. Doing so may cause your download to be interrupted.